Excel 2020: Uçucu Olmayan OFSET olarak A2: INDEX () kullanın - Excel İpuçları

İçindekiler

OFFSET adlı esnek bir işlev vardır. Anında hesaplanan farklı büyüklükteki bir aralığa işaret edebilir. Aşağıdaki resimde, birisi H1'deki # Qtrs açılır menüsünü 3'ten 4'e değiştirirse, KAYDIR'ın dördüncü argümanı aralığın dört sütunu içerecek şekilde genişlemesini sağlayacaktır.

Elektronik tablo uzmanları, geçici bir işlev olduğu için OFFSET'ten nefret eder. Tamamen ilgisiz bir hücreye gidip bir sayı girerseniz, hücrenin H1 veya B2 ile ilgisi olmasa bile tüm KAYDIRMA işlevleri hesaplayacaktır. Excel çoğu zaman yalnızca hesaplaması gereken hücreleri hesaplamak için çok dikkatli davranır. Ancak OFSET'i sunduğunuzda, tüm OFSET hücreleri artı OFSET'ten gelen her şey, çalışma sayfasındaki her değişiklikten sonra hesaplamaya başlar.

Aşağıdaki formülde, INDEX işlevinden önce bir iki nokta üst üste vardır. Normalde, aşağıda gösterilen INDEX işlevi, 1403'ü D2 hücresinden döndürür. Ancak INDEX işlevinin her iki tarafına iki nokta üst üste koyduğunuzda, D2'nin içeriği yerine D2 hücre adresini döndürmeye başlar. Bunun işe yaraması vahşi.

Bu neden önemli? INDEX uçucu değil. OFFSET'in tüm esnek güzelliklerini defalarca zaman emen yeniden hesaplamalar yapmadan elde edersiniz.

Bu ipucunu ilk olarak Fintega'daki Dan Mayoh'dan öğrendim. Bu özelliği önerdiği için Access Analytic'e teşekkür ederiz.

Ilginç makaleler...